Description
Comprehensive preparation, study and test tool for the Remote Pilot (small Unmanned Aircraft System, sUAS) FAA Knowledge Exam. Nearly 300 sample questions, answers and explanations included, for you to study by subject or with a true-to-form practice test. Compatible with Android phones and tablets, this app provides a mobile solution for pilots and drone operators preparing for their FAA “written” exam. Study by subject, supported with explanations. Take practice tests, and review the graded test.
Operating a drone for non-hobby operations requires a Remote Pilot Certificate. Applicants must successfully complete the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) Knowledge Exam to earn the Remote Pilot Certificate with a Small Unmanned Aircraft Systems (sUAS) rating. This app is the key to test success.
Rely on the time-tested and dependable ASA Prepware apps to prepare for your FAA Knowledge Exam. Test material is expertly organized into chapters based on subject matter and includes instructional text and illustrations, multiple-choice questions, answer stems, correct answers, explanations (for correct and incorrect answers), and references for further study. This topical study promotes understanding and aids recall to provide an efficient study guide.
Subjects covered include Regulations, National Airspace System, Weather, Loading and Performance, and Operations. This app will be particularly helpful for drone operators interested in earning a Remote Pilot certificate, Remote Pilot Aircraft (RPA) applicants, Unmanned Aircraft System (UAS) training programs preparing applicants for FAA Knowledge exams, self-study applicants interested in learning more about commercial unmanned aircraft operations, and existing (manned aircraft) pilots interested in learning more about drone and unmanned aircraft operations who are sharing the National Airspace System.

★★☆☆☆Drew Wilson· Nov 5, 2018
There are only two modes. Test and study. Study has an "explanation" button to explain the question. It's not a traditional type of study where you read something first THEN take the test. But the chart section seems to be functionally useless. It asks you what the class airspace is around a given airport, and refers you to the chart. The thing is, you need to the key to figure out what type of airspace the squiggly lines represent, and they don't show the key! When you hit the explanation it says its "Class D" or "Class C" and cites the key. But again, the key is not actually provided, so it really does no good. Maybe I am missing something, but I don't see the key readily available.
